Implementation Strategies for Maximum Protection


Okay, so youre thinking about grabbing some software in 2025, huh? And youre rightly worried about those pesky backdoors. Listen, finding affordable backdoor protection isnt just about throwing money at the problem; its about smart implementation strategies. Were talking about layers of defense.



First off, dont underestimate the power of robust vendor due diligence. (Seriously, do your homework!). It's not just about reading reviews; it's about probing the vendors security practices, asking about their incident response plan, and demanding transparency. You wouldnt buy a used car without kicking the tires, would you? Its crucial to ascertain if they have a history of vulnerabilities or, worse, actual breaches. Neglecting this step is like leaving your front door wide open.



Next, think about "least privilege." This means granting users (and software processes) only the minimum access they need to perform their tasks. It isnt a complicated concept, but its incredibly effective. If a backdoor does sneak in, its ability to cause damage is significantly limited because it wont have carte blanche access to everything.



Furthermore, continuous monitoring and threat detection are absolutely essential. (I mean, absolutely). Were not talking about a one-time security audit; this is an ongoing process. managed services new york city Implement intrusion detection systems (IDS) and security information and event management (SIEM) solutions to identify suspicious activity. These tools can analyze logs and network traffic, flagging anomalies that could indicate a backdoor is being exploited. Ignoring this is akin to driving without a rearview mirror.



Finally, and this is key: keep everything updated! Software patches often address known vulnerabilities that backdoors can exploit. Its tempting to postpone updates (I know, I know!), but resisting the urge is vital. Automated patching can help streamline this process, ensuring that security updates are applied promptly.



Implementing these strategies doesnt have to break the bank. Open-source tools and cloud-based security services can provide affordable alternatives to traditional, expensive solutions. The key is to find the right mix that fits your budget and risk tolerance. So, dont panic! With a little planning and diligent execution, you can secure those software deals in 2025 without leaving yourself vulnerable. Good luck!

Future Trends in Affordable Cybersecurity


Alright, lets talk about where things are heading with affordable backdoor protection in software deals by 2025. Its not just about slapping on a firewall and calling it a day, is it? Were seeing some serious shifts.



One big trend is the rise of AI-powered threat detection (its getting smarter, thankfully!). These systems arent just looking for known signatures; theyre learning normal software behavior and flagging anomalies that could indicate a backdoor. Its not a perfect solution, but its a significant step up from traditional methods. Think of it as a digital bloodhound, sniffing out anything suspicious.



Another key area is the growing importance of supply chain security. We cant just assume that software from well-known vendors is inherently safe (sadly!). Theres been a huge push for better verification processes, ensuring that code isnt tampered with during development or distribution. This includes things like software composition analysis (SCA) and improved code signing practices. Its no longer acceptable to ignore where your software comes from!



Then theres the democratization of security tools. Previously, advanced backdoor protection was only available to large enterprises with deep pockets. But now, cloud-based solutions and open-source projects are making these tools more accessible. Were seeing smaller businesses and even individuals able to afford robust protection, which is fantastic. Its not just for the big guys anymore!



Finally, lets not forget about the increasing focus on vulnerability disclosure programs (VDPs). Encouraging ethical hackers to find and report vulnerabilities before theyre exploited is becoming increasingly common. This proactive approach helps vendors patch vulnerabilities before they can be turned into backdoors. Its a win-win!



So, as we look towards 2025, affordable backdoor protection isnt about one silver bullet. Its a combination of smarter technology, a more secure supply chain, greater accessibility, and a collaborative approach to vulnerability management. managed service new york Its evolving, and frankly, it should be!
